Workshop Keynote Speaker Kevin Hallenbeck took the stage to emphasize the importance of creating long-term relationships with businesses. Then, in breakout groups, we discussed strategies to improve large account sales:
๐ Identifying and neutralizing competition โ either internal or external.
โ Customizing your sales process for an enterprise account.
๐ Having more than 1 contact (even if you think you only need one).
Mark Tortorici covered all things AI to prepare our franchisees with the latest tools to gain a competitive edge in sourcing:
๐ก The logistics of incorporating AI as a tool to work more efficiently.
โ Remembering to always question the results.
๐ญGetting specific with Boolean search strings.

For the 2023 GRN Regional meetings, we are excited to focus on the Science Behind Sales with Kevin Hallenbeck of Sandler Training. A salesforce development expert, he has consistently helped progressive companies worldwide to increase sales and develop stronger customer relationships using unique, non-traditional sales strategies and tactics. Kevin will help teach our network the Sandler System, which can help our offices grow the business and improve our sales teams.
